A citation is a written notice issued by law enforcement detailing the charged violation and the court date. It sets in motion a formal process that may involve payment of fines, enrollment in alternatives, or a court appearance. Understanding what a citation means helps you plan your next steps and coordinate with your attorney to address the charge effectively.
License suspension is a temporary removal of driving privileges after certain violations or a series of offenses. The duration depends on the offense and prior driving history, and reinstatement often requires administrative steps, fees, or compliance with terms. Knowing how suspensions arise and how they can be challenged or mitigated is essential to protecting your mobility.
An arraignment is a court proceeding where you enter a plea to the charges. It marks the formal start of the case in the criminal or traffic court. Attending or having counsel attend on your behalf helps ensure your rights are protected and that you receive clear information about potential defenses and next steps.
An administrative hearing is a non-criminal review, often conducted by a state agency, regarding the consequences of traffic violations. These hearings can affect licenses, points, and penalties. Understanding the process and preparing effectively can influence outcomes, sometimes avoiding more severe sanctions.
